Transaction 2120078b9256ba72c0da367f956e3d1752853c746a5914b9f113e2c95a068403
1 Input
1 Output
-
2120078b9256ba72c0da367f956e3d1752853c746a5914b9f113e2c95a068403:0
- value
- 18030433
- script pubkey
- OP_0 OP_PUSHBYTES_20 23dbe3673e02de6de0c26fc3b30dbf92ebfb5702
- address
- bc1qy0d7xee7qt0xmcxzdlpmxrdljt4lk4cz7gwnfv